Appearance & Personality

Fair skin, snowy hair, odd eyes. Lucaell is of almost average build and average height - she does enough outdoors activities to be fit, but isn't really brawny. Pretty yes, but only through relative efforts. Like most performers, the girl takes care of her appearance daily, and behind the cosmetics, any eye can see an ordinary, plain, mundane round face. If it wasn't for the powder, Caell's face would be easily forgotten.
She is as pale as a ghost and acts like one. The girl's expressions are absolutely neutral. She's extremely hard to read and, although understanding humor and using it quite often (in her own way), is rarely seen laughing out loud after a good joke. There are times she just spaces out. She's soft-spoken, her voice is rather high-pitched, but she always speaks in a slow, hushed, almost monotonous tone. To top the cold beauty trope, the girl's words are sometimes disturbingly cryptic.
The girl has nerves of steel and is a patient being in general. The façade is thick and well built: she will keep her head cool in almost all situations. It takes a lot to make her openly uncomfortable, angry, or overjoyed, and can be slightly frustrating for people looking for/expecting strong reactions. Luca is outgoing and an absolute extrovert. She is a people person, enjoys long discussions and tries to launch debates every time she is able to do so. She can be surprisingly opinionated at times, but is always willing to consider other viewpoints. In the same manner, she tends to over-think many things. Coupled with her laziness, she can become quite the indecisive character. She's perceptive, but then again, her ability to doubt things, anything at all, can be either rewarding or a huge waste of time.
She's fascinated by outer beauty and colors, and tends to always compliment people at random, especially strangers. Good at dealing with kids and elders.

Present

The girl is most often seen in Ul'dah. According to her, she visited the city for the first time three years ago or so. She's been an adventurer since then, but definitely the lazy kind. Only taking contracts when large sums of money are absolutely needed in the week or when she sees a new instrument she'd like, she prefers to play music to put bread on the table in general.
